ImageEditor.st
changeset 617 463306131678
parent 611 ba39b8506e97
child 618 2c9efaae88a6
equal deleted inserted replaced
616:9d9bccf8304c 617:463306131678
    12 
    12 
    13 ToolApplicationModel subclass:#ImageEditor
    13 ToolApplicationModel subclass:#ImageEditor
    14 	instanceVariableNames:'colorMapMode selectedColorIndex postOpenAction'
    14 	instanceVariableNames:'colorMapMode selectedColorIndex postOpenAction'
    15 	classVariableNames:''
    15 	classVariableNames:''
    16 	poolDictionaries:''
    16 	poolDictionaries:''
    17 	category:'Interface-Advanced-Tools'
    17 	category:'Interface-UIPainter'
    18 !
    18 !
    19 
    19 
    20 !ImageEditor class methodsFor:'documentation'!
    20 !ImageEditor class methodsFor:'documentation'!
    21 
    21 
    22 copyright
    22 copyright
   278      
   278      
   279        #(#FullSpec
   279        #(#FullSpec
   280           #'window:' 
   280           #'window:' 
   281            #(#WindowSpec
   281            #(#WindowSpec
   282               #'name:' 'Image Editor'
   282               #'name:' 'Image Editor'
   283               #'layout:' #(#LayoutFrame 69 0 265 0 568 0 610 0)
   283               #'layout:' #(#LayoutFrame 26 0 344 0 363 0 640 0)
   284               #'label:' 'Image Editor'
   284               #'label:' 'Image Editor'
   285               #'min:' #(#Point 400 320)
   285               #'min:' #(#Point 200 200)
   286               #'max:' #(#Point 1152 900)
   286               #'max:' #(#Point 1152 900)
   287               #'bounds:' #(#Rectangle 69 265 569 611)
   287               #'bounds:' #(#Rectangle 26 344 364 641)
   288               #'menu:' #menu
   288               #'menu:' #menu
   289               #'usePreferredExtent:' false
   289               #'usePreferredExtent:' false
   290           )
   290           )
   291           #'component:' 
   291           #'component:' 
   292            #(#SpecCollection
   292            #(#SpecCollection
   392                                                         #'rendererType:' #rowSelector
   392                                                         #'rendererType:' #rowSelector
   393                                                         #'backgroundSelector:' #yourself
   393                                                         #'backgroundSelector:' #yourself
   394                                                     )
   394                                                     )
   395                                                      #(#DataSetColumnSpec
   395                                                      #(#DataSetColumnSpec
   396                                                         #'label:' 'Red'
   396                                                         #'label:' 'Red'
       
   397                                                         #'labelForegroundColor:' #(#Color 100.0 0.0 0.0)
       
   398                                                         #'labelFont:' #(#FontDescription #clean #medium #roman 12)
   397                                                         #'model:' #rowRedByte
   399                                                         #'model:' #rowRedByte
   398                                                         #'canSelect:' false
   400                                                         #'canSelect:' false
   399                                                     )
   401                                                     )
   400                                                      #(#DataSetColumnSpec
   402                                                      #(#DataSetColumnSpec
   401                                                         #'label:' 'Green'
   403                                                         #'label:' 'Green'
       
   404                                                         #'labelForegroundColor:' #(#Color 0.0 100.0 0.0)
   402                                                         #'model:' #rowGreenByte
   405                                                         #'model:' #rowGreenByte
   403                                                         #'canSelect:' false
   406                                                         #'canSelect:' false
   404                                                     )
   407                                                     )
   405                                                      #(#DataSetColumnSpec
   408                                                      #(#DataSetColumnSpec
   406                                                         #'label:' 'Blue'
   409                                                         #'label:' 'Blue'
       
   410                                                         #'labelForegroundColor:' #(#Color 0.0 0.0 100.0)
   407                                                         #'model:' #rowBlueByte
   411                                                         #'model:' #rowBlueByte
   408                                                         #'canSelect:' false
   412                                                         #'canSelect:' false
   409                                                     )
   413                                                     )
   410                                                   )
   414                                                   )
   411                                               )
   415                                               )
   465                                                #(#InputFieldSpec
   469                                                #(#InputFieldSpec
   466                                                   #'name:' 'resourceClassInputField'
   470                                                   #'name:' 'resourceClassInputField'
   467                                                   #'activeHelpKey:' #inputFieldOfClass
   471                                                   #'activeHelpKey:' #inputFieldOfClass
   468                                                   #'model:' #valueOfResourceClass
   472                                                   #'model:' #valueOfResourceClass
   469                                                   #'immediateAccept:' false
   473                                                   #'immediateAccept:' false
   470                                                   #'extent:' #(#Point 107 21)
   474                                                   #'extent:' #(#Point 41 21)
   471                                               )
   475                                               )
   472                                                #(#InputFieldSpec
   476                                                #(#InputFieldSpec
   473                                                   #'name:' 'resourceSelectorInputField'
   477                                                   #'name:' 'resourceSelectorInputField'
   474                                                   #'activeHelpKey:' #inputFieldOfSelector
   478                                                   #'activeHelpKey:' #inputFieldOfSelector
   475                                                   #'model:' #valueOfResourceSelector
   479                                                   #'model:' #valueOfResourceSelector
   476                                                   #'immediateAccept:' false
   480                                                   #'immediateAccept:' false
   477                                                   #'acceptOnTab:' false
   481                                                   #'acceptOnTab:' false
   478                                                   #'extent:' #(#Point 107 20)
   482                                                   #'extent:' #(#Point 41 20)
   479                                               )
   483                                               )
   480                                                #(#InputFieldSpec
   484                                                #(#InputFieldSpec
   481                                                   #'name:' 'fileNameInputField'
   485                                                   #'name:' 'fileNameInputField'
   482                                                   #'activeHelpKey:' #inputFieldFileName
   486                                                   #'activeHelpKey:' #inputFieldFileName
   483                                                   #'model:' #valueOfFileName
   487                                                   #'model:' #valueOfFileName
   484                                                   #'immediateAccept:' false
   488                                                   #'immediateAccept:' false
   485                                                   #'acceptOnTab:' false
   489                                                   #'acceptOnTab:' false
   486                                                   #'extent:' #(#Point 107 21)
   490                                                   #'extent:' #(#Point 41 21)
   487                                               )
   491                                               )
   488                                             )
   492                                             )
   489                                         )
   493                                         )
   490                                         #'horizontalLayout:' #fit
   494                                         #'horizontalLayout:' #fit
   491                                         #'verticalLayout:' #fit
   495                                         #'verticalLayout:' #fit